Image Processing with

ITK The Image Segmentation and Registration Toolkit

Insight Toolkit (ITK) • www.itk.org

• Started in 2000

• Image Processing Toolkit

– C++ library (+2 million LOC)

– Automatic bindings: Java, Python, TCL

– Portable by design: Linux, Windows, Mac OSX,

Solaris…

• Very active community: 1500+ registered users

• Initially developed for the visible human

• Image Processing

• Segmentation

• Registration

• No Graphical User Interface (GUI)

• No Visualization

What is ITK?

#include "itkImage.h"

#include "itkImageFileReader.h"

#include "itkGradientMagnitudeImageFilter.h"

int main( int argc, char **argv ) {

typedef itk::Image<unsigned short,2> ImageType;

typedef itk::ImageFileReader<ImageType> ReaderType;

typedef itk::GradientMagnitudeImageFilter<

ImageType,ImageType> FilterType;

ReaderType::Pointer reader = ReaderType::New();

FilterType::Pointer filter = FilterType::New();

reader->SetFileName( argv[1] );

filter->SetInput( reader->GetOutput() );

filter->Update();

return 0;

}

ITK Minimal Example

• Region Growing

– ConfidenceConnected

– ConnectedThreshold

– IsolatedConnected

• Watersheds

• Level Sets

– FastMarching

– ShapeDetection

– GeodesicActiveContours

– ThresholdSegmentation

– CannySegmentationLevelSet

Segmentation Algorithms

• Transforms

– Linear: Translation, Rigid, Affine

– Deformable: B-Spline, TP-Spline, Daemon

• Metrics

– Mean square

– Cross-correlation

– Mutual Information

– …

• Optimizers

– Gradient Descent

– Genetic algorithms

– Conjugate gradient

– …

• Interpolators

Registration Algorithms
